network_debugger_workspace
This workspace contains the following packages.
Packages
dio_debugger
Lightweight utility to attach a reverse/forward proxy to an existing Dio instance for local debugging.
| Library | Description |
|---|---|
| dio_debugger | Library for enabling HTTP request debugging through a proxy server. |
firebase_database_debugger
Helper package to send Firebase Realtime Database operations to network-debugger ingest API.
| Library | Description |
|---|---|
| firebase_database_debugger | Library for intercepting and sending Firebase Realtime Database operations to network-debugger for visual debugging. |
| firebase_database_debugger_config | Helper package to send Firebase Realtime Database operations to network-debugger ingest API. |
| firebase_ingest_client | Helper package to send Firebase Realtime Database operations to network-debugger ingest API. |
| models | Helper package to send Firebase Realtime Database operations to network-debugger ingest API. |
hex_viewer
Zero-dependency hexadecimal viewer widget for Flutter with selection, copy, and byte grouping support.
| Library | Description |
|---|---|
| byte_color_scheme | Zero-dependency hexadecimal viewer widget for Flutter with selection, copy, and byte grouping support. |
| byte_selection | Zero-dependency hexadecimal viewer widget for Flutter with selection, copy, and byte grouping support. |
| column_width_calculator | Zero-dependency hexadecimal viewer widget for Flutter with selection, copy, and byte grouping support. |
| hex_config | Zero-dependency hexadecimal viewer widget for Flutter with selection, copy, and byte grouping support. |
| hex_controls | Zero-dependency hexadecimal viewer widget for Flutter with selection, copy, and byte grouping support. |
| hex_formatter | Zero-dependency hexadecimal viewer widget for Flutter with selection, copy, and byte grouping support. |
| hex_header | Zero-dependency hexadecimal viewer widget for Flutter with selection, copy, and byte grouping support. |
| hex_line | Zero-dependency hexadecimal viewer widget for Flutter with selection, copy, and byte grouping support. |
| hex_row | Zero-dependency hexadecimal viewer widget for Flutter with selection, copy, and byte grouping support. |
| hex_viewer | Zero-dependency hexadecimal viewer widget for Flutter |
| hex_viewer_widget | Zero-dependency hexadecimal viewer widget for Flutter with selection, copy, and byte grouping support. |
http_debugger
Global HTTP interceptor via HttpOverrides to proxy all traffic through local network debugger.
| Library | Description |
|---|---|
| http_client_wrapper | Global HTTP interceptor via HttpOverrides to proxy all traffic through local network debugger. |
| http_debugger | Library for debugging HTTP requests through a proxy server. |
| overrides_stub | Global HTTP interceptor via HttpOverrides to proxy all traffic through local network debugger. |
network_debugger
Launcher for network-debugger binary with automatic download, caching, and process management.
| Library | Description |
|---|---|
| binary_cache | Launcher for network-debugger binary with automatic download, caching, and process management. |
| binary_downloader | Launcher for network-debugger binary with automatic download, caching, and process management. |
| checksum_validator | Launcher for network-debugger binary with automatic download, caching, and process management. |
| debugger_process | Launcher for network-debugger binary with automatic download, caching, and process management. |
| error_formatter | Launcher for network-debugger binary with automatic download, caching, and process management. |
| github_release | Launcher for network-debugger binary with automatic download, caching, and process management. |
| logger | Launcher for network-debugger binary with automatic download, caching, and process management. |
| network_debugger | Launcher for network-debugger binary with automatic download and caching. |
| platform_detector | Launcher for network-debugger binary with automatic download, caching, and process management. |
| retry_helper | Launcher for network-debugger binary with automatic download, caching, and process management. |
network_debugger_workspace
socket_io_debugger
One-call proxy helper for Socket.IO client: reverse/forward modes for local debugging.
| Library | Description |
|---|---|
| socket_io_debugger | Library for debugging Socket.IO connections through a proxy server. |
web_socket_channel_debugger
Helper to attach network-debugger proxy to package:web_socket_channel (reverse/forward).
| Library | Description |
|---|---|
| env_reader_stub | Helper to attach network-debugger proxy to package:web_socket_channel (reverse/forward). |
| forward_proxy_stub | Helper to attach network-debugger proxy to package:web_socket_channel (reverse/forward). |
| url_tools | Helper to attach network-debugger proxy to package:web_socket_channel (reverse/forward). |
| web_socket_channel_debugger | Library for debugging WebSocket connections through a proxy server. |
web_socket_debugger
Helper to attach network-debugger proxy to package:web_socket (reverse/forward).
| Library | Description |
|---|---|
| env_reader_stub | Helper to attach network-debugger proxy to package:web_socket (reverse/forward). |
| forward_proxy_stub | Helper to attach network-debugger proxy to package:web_socket (reverse/forward). |
| url_tools | Helper to attach network-debugger proxy to package:web_socket (reverse/forward). |
| web_socket_debugger | Library for debugging WebSocket connections through a proxy server. |
| ws_connector_stub | Helper to attach network-debugger proxy to package:web_socket (reverse/forward). |